
網(wǎng)站建設(shè)與軟件開發(fā)是相輔相成的技術(shù)領(lǐng)域,前者聚焦于搭建線上展示與交互平臺,后者則側(cè)重通過編程實現(xiàn)特定功能的系統(tǒng)或工具。以下從核心內(nèi)容、技術(shù)棧、服務(wù)流程及注意事項等方面進行梳理:
一、網(wǎng)站建設(shè)核心內(nèi)容
1. 類型劃分
- 展示型網(wǎng)站:企業(yè)官網(wǎng)、品牌官網(wǎng)等,側(cè)重信息傳遞(公司簡介、產(chǎn)品展示、聯(lián)系方式),結(jié)構(gòu)簡單,注重UI設(shè)計和響應式適配(PC+移動端)。
- 功能型網(wǎng)站:電商網(wǎng)站(帶支付、訂單管理)、社區(qū)論壇(用戶注冊、互動)、資訊平臺(內(nèi)容發(fā)布、搜索)等,需開發(fā)會員系統(tǒng)、數(shù)據(jù)交互等功能。
- 定制化網(wǎng)站:根據(jù)企業(yè)特殊需求開發(fā),如多語言切換、API對接(第三方工具如支付接口、CRM系統(tǒng))、數(shù)據(jù)可視化等。
2. 技術(shù)棧
- 前端:HTML5、CSS3、JavaScript(框架如Vue、React、jQuery),負責頁面呈現(xiàn)和用戶交互。
- 后端:編程語言(PHP、Python、Java、Node.js)+ 數(shù)據(jù)庫(MySQL、MongoDB),處理數(shù)據(jù)邏輯和服務(wù)器交互。
- 服務(wù)器與部署:云服務(wù)器(阿里云、騰訊云)、域名備案、SSL證書(HTTPS加密)、CDN加速(提升訪問速度)。
二、軟件開發(fā)核心內(nèi)容
1. 類型劃分
- 桌面軟件:如辦公軟件、行業(yè)專用工具(設(shè)計軟件、數(shù)據(jù)分析工具),常用技術(shù):C、C++、Python(PyQt框架)。
- 移動端APP:
- 原生開發(fā):iOS(Swift/Objective-C)、Android(Kotlin/Java),性能優(yōu)但開發(fā)成本高;
- 跨平臺開發(fā):Flutter、React Native,一套代碼適配多端,適合預算有限的項目。
- Web應用:基于瀏覽器的在線系統(tǒng)(如OA系統(tǒng)、CRM系統(tǒng)),技術(shù)棧與功能型網(wǎng)站類似,但更側(cè)重復雜業(yè)務(wù)邏輯(如流程審批、數(shù)據(jù)統(tǒng)計)。
- 小程序:微信/支付寶小程序,用騰訊/阿里自研框架(如微信小程序的WXML+WXSS+JavaScript),輕量化且獲客成本低。
2. 核心流程
- 需求分析:明確功能邊界(如“電商APP需支持多規(guī)格商品下單”)、用戶場景(B端還是C端使用)、性能要求(如并發(fā)量)。
- 原型設(shè)計:用Axure等工具繪制頁面流程和交互邏輯,確認功能可行性。
- 開發(fā)測試:分模塊編碼,同步進行單元測試、集成測試(如壓力測試、兼容性測試)。
- 部署維護:上線后監(jiān)控BUG,定期迭代功能(如根據(jù)用戶反饋優(yōu)化交互)。
三、網(wǎng)站建設(shè)與軟件開發(fā)的關(guān)聯(lián)與區(qū)別
- 關(guān)聯(lián):兩者均需通過編程實現(xiàn)功能,很多項目會結(jié)合(如“電商網(wǎng)站+配套管理APP”),且都依賴服務(wù)器和數(shù)據(jù)庫技術(shù)。
- 區(qū)別:
- 網(wǎng)站更側(cè)重“線上入口”,依賴瀏覽器訪問,開發(fā)周期短(展示型網(wǎng)站1-2周,功能型3-8周);
- 軟件更側(cè)重“專項功能”,可獨立運行(如桌面軟件),開發(fā)周期長(簡單APP1-3個月,復雜系統(tǒng)3-12個月)。
四、選擇服務(wù)時的注意事項
1. 明確需求優(yōu)先級:
- 若僅需線上展示,優(yōu)先選擇模板化建站(成本低,3000-8000元);
- 若需復雜功能(如定制化訂單系統(tǒng)),需定制開發(fā)(費用1萬-10萬+,按功能復雜度計算)。
2. 技術(shù)適配性:
- 電商類建議用PHP(WordPress+WooCommerce插件)或Java(穩(wěn)定性強);
- 數(shù)據(jù)密集型系統(tǒng)(如ERP)優(yōu)先選Python(數(shù)據(jù)分析庫豐富)或Java。
3. 售后與維護:
- 網(wǎng)站需定期更新內(nèi)容、備份數(shù)據(jù),軟件需修復BUG、適配新系統(tǒng)(如iOS新版本),建議選擇提供1-2年售后的服務(wù)商。
4. 避免過度開發(fā):根據(jù)實際需求選擇技術(shù)方案,例如中小企業(yè)無需為簡單官網(wǎng)采用分布式服務(wù)器架構(gòu),以免增加成本。
五、典型應用場景
- 企業(yè)官網(wǎng)建設(shè)+CRM客戶管理系統(tǒng)開發(fā)(打通網(wǎng)站表單數(shù)據(jù)與客戶跟進流程);
- 電商網(wǎng)站+移動端APP(實現(xiàn)多端同步購物車、訂單);
- 教育機構(gòu)線上平臺(網(wǎng)站展示課程+小程序直播/打卡功能)。
無論是網(wǎng)站建設(shè)還是軟件開發(fā),核心是“以用戶需求為中心”,平衡功能、成本與迭代能力,選擇匹配自身業(yè)務(wù)場景的技術(shù)方案。
相關(guān)推薦: